WebCrawford v. Metropolitan Government of Nashville and Davidson County, Tennessee. Issue: Does the anti-retaliation provision of Title VII of the Civil Rights Act apply to employees fired for participating in an internal investigation of sexual harassment? Held: YES. The anti-retaliation provision provision of Title VII extends to people who ... WebSep 15, 2024 · Yes.
